Measurements of branching fraction and direct CP asymmetry in B+ → Ks Ks K+ and a search for B+ → Ks Ks pi+ Belle experiment

Description
Charmless hadronic decays of charged B-mesons to the three-body final states of KSKSK+ and KSKSpi+ proceed via b → s and b → d loop transitions, respectively.  These flavor-changing neutral current transitions, being suppressed in the standard model (SM), are interesting as they could be sensitive to possible non SM contributions. We present an improved measurement of the branching fraction and direct CP asymmetry of the decay B+ → KSKSK+ as well as a search for B+ → KSKSpi+ using a data sample of 711 fb^−1, which contains 772 × 10^6 BB-pairs and was recorded near the Y(4S) resonance with the Belle detector at the KEKB e+e− collider.
